European Training and Mobility Research Fellowships
Research Students from the European Union may be able to apply for Training and Mobility in Research Grants to fund their research - please visit the CORDIS homepage at http://cordis.europa.eu/home_en.html for further information.
Overseas Research Students Awards
These are available to non-EU research students, and if successful you will be awarded the difference between Home and Overseas fees. For further information please see http://www.universitiesuk.ac.uk
British Council
The main source of funding for overseas students is the British Council - please contact them when applying for your course for more information, or see http://www.britishcouncil.org.uk.
Career Development Loans
Available to those intending to live or train in the UK, a maximum loan of £8,000 is available. For further details please visit your local bank or see http://www.lifelonglearning.co.uk/cdl/
